package pluginctl
import (
"fmt"
"path/filepath"
)
// RunManifestCommand implements the 'manifest' command functionality with subcommands.
func RunManifestCommand(args []string, pluginPath string) error {
if len(args) == 0 {
return fmt.Errorf("manifest command requires a subcommand: id, version, has_server, has_webapp, check")
}
// Convert to absolute path
absPath, err := filepath.Abs(pluginPath)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to resolve path: %w", err)
}
// Load plugin manifest
manifest, err := LoadPluginManifestFromPath(absPath)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to load plugin manifest: %w", err)
}
subcommand := args[0]
switch subcommand {
case "id":
fmt.Println(manifest.Id)
case "version":
fmt.Println(manifest.Version)
case "has_server":
if HasServerCode(manifest) {
fmt.Println("true")
} else {
fmt.Println("false")
}
case "has_webapp":
if HasWebappCode(manifest) {
fmt.Println("true")
} else {
fmt.Println("false")
}
case "check":
if err := manifest.IsValid(); err != nil {
Logger.Error("Plugin manifest validation failed", "error", err)
return err
}
Logger.Info("Plugin manifest is valid")
default:
return fmt.Errorf("unknown subcommand: %s. Available subcommands: id, version, has_server, has_webapp, check",
subcommand)
}
return nil
}
